Film development? by theogpburdell in NewOrleans

[–]RealSoupy 0 points1 point  (0 children)

New Orleans Community Printshop and Darkroom has open shops on Tuesday and Thursdays from 6pm to 10pm. They only have the darkroom open to the public on Thursday nights but it costs $5 to develop a roll of film and $7 per hour to print photos. Or you could become a member and have 24/7 access.

Home security - what do you use? Especially renters. by [deleted] in NewOrleans

[–]RealSoupy 0 points1 point  (0 children)

The one downside to alarm systems though are the false alarms--like if you accidentally trigger it or it seems to mysteriously go off by itself (this happened a couple times to me). If the security system is linked to a dispatcher you might end up with some unnecessary visits from the police and I've been told that since there's so many false alarms around this city that the police might start charging people for it after the third occurrence.
